Utrik, Marshall Islands climate

Aw Tropical savanna (dry winter)

Utrik has a remarkably steady tropical climate (Tropical savanna (dry winter), Köppen Aw). The hottest month is September with an average daily high near 83°F, while the coldest is February averaging around 80°F at night. Precipitation totals about 67 inches a year and is strongly seasonal — September alone averages 11.9 inches while February barely receives 1.12 inches.

Methodology & sources

Temperature — modelled for this location from ERA5-Land reanalysis, a ~9 km global grid, because no long-record weather station is close enough to use.

Precipitation — 1991–2020 normals computed from 9 years of daily observations at Utirik, a weather station, inside the city. The underlying daily records come from NOAA's global station network.

Cloud, humidity, wind & sunshine — modelled estimates from NASA POWER, NASA's satellite-and-reanalysis climatology. This is the standard global source for atmospheric variables, which are not measured at most weather stations.
